Kinetic Training
Training programs include Small Group Personal Training, Personal Training, Group Training, Sports Performance, and Nutrition coaching. Classes feature Boxing, Kinetic Energy, Semi-Private Training, and Open Gym, focusing on strength, speed, technique, and conditioning. Semi-Private Training provides individualized programs in small groups, while Open Gym allows independent workouts.
Memberships start at $130 per month. Hours are Monday-Thursday 7:00 AM-8:00 PM, Friday 7:00 AM-6:00 PM, and weekends 8:00 AM-2:00 PM. The facility is equipped with Olympic barbells, squat racks, free weights, cable machines, kettlebells, and resistance bands.
Certified trainers specialize in strength and conditioning, mobility, sports performance, powerlifting, boxing, and nutrition coaching. The team includes a Doctor of Physical Therapy and a Masters of Nutrition Science. New members can schedule a Free Intro session to meet coaches and discuss goals.

Schott's Boxing
Classes follow a 12-round circuit (3 minutes work, 1 minute rest) using heavy bags, mitts, speed bags, and more, lasting 55 minutes. Options include boxing sessions, boot camps, and a Friday Parkinson's Boxing Class. Pricing starts at $20 per class, with memberships from $115-$625 or $89/month (4-month minimum).
Open weekdays and Saturday mornings, the gym offers a family atmosphere with professional staff. Expect cardio endurance, fat loss, and self-defense skills. New participants should arrive 20 minutes early. Contact: 518-641-9064 or [email protected].
